What’s in a name? Plenty, if the name is the one that will appear on the front of Sedalia’s new high school.

And when it comes to their alma mater, Sedalians show a fierce loyalty. One of the big stumbling blocks to winning voter approval for a new high school was the widespread sentiment that Smith-Cotton High School had served generations of students well and was plenty good enough for generations to come. Never mind that the building was overcrowded, the auditorium dreary, the science labs looked as though they were the 1925 originals and the antiquated electrical system couldn’t handle the load from the lights and a fan at the same time, let alone a bank of computers.
